logo

Output 6fb93561e8d987486a302f10ad9c894b4238d4fd9bf10c10104f20dd88685148:0

value
1340656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d666b1f19d7f0ebfd83b8cca264009e51d40284 OP_EQUALVERIFY OP_CHECKSIG
address
1MBf2Z4M4XQdS9Q7ann1w1Vq81MYB9vgPB
transaction
6fb93561e8d987486a302f10ad9c894b4238d4fd9bf10c10104f20dd88685148